I havent been YET but I am going in a month. All-inclusive at the RIU hotels gives you all-inclusive access to any of their 5 resorts (ie: you can use their restaurants, bars, lounges, clubs, etc for free). There are refillable liquor dispsnsers in the room, free water sports, etc etc. The ONLY thing we pay extra for is the spa. 8 days plus flight was around $1100, and that included groudn transpo from cancun. Not bad, sonsidering its the nicest resorts in town AND you get access to all 5. :crazy:

Try Selloffvacations.com first - they have the lowest mark-up on any trip. One issue with RIU is that its all inclusive and all events are off the property so all-inclusive is not really needed for BPM.

If you want a really good price on a non all inclusive try www.breakawaytours.com which has a place right downtown within walking distance of all the events.

I think it helps because you have free pre-game drinks, free food, free water activities, tips and taxes, etc....buy the BPM ticket and you are pretty much set for the week.

You really have to compare if the package is going to be more or less than the extra spending money you will need for the "non" free food and drinks all week.

I used expedia. During mid-week their prices are the lowest.

Yup, Riu is amazing, that's where I went last year (not to BPM, just to Mexico). All-inclusive really means all-inclusive and they work very hard to keep everybody entertained and happy.

$1100 for a week sounds about right if you book reasonably well in advance. I just went on Travelocity (or maybe Expedia) and booked the cheapest one, lol - I think it was Sunquest but it might have been Signature. They're all pretty much the same.

You don't have to get all-inclusive... but I think you'd regret doing it any other way. Every one of these events will milk you. I'm just thinking of DEMF, the fiasco with the VIP drink tickets, how much we spent at the hotel and the liquor store... you'll have a much better time knowing you can swing back to the hotel pretty much whenever you want for R&R&R.
